Job Description

  • Leading and continuously improving the company-wide safety program
  • Overseeing safety across multiple ground-up commercial construction projects
  • Conducting project site audits, inspections and safety assessments
  • Developing and enforcing site-specific safety plans and risk-management procedures
  • Ensuring compliance with OSHA regulations and company safety standards
  • Leading safety training, orientations, toolbox talks and ongoing field education
  • Partnering with Superintendents and operational leadership to promote accountability in the field
  • Managing incident investigations, reporting and corrective actions
  • Monitoring safety trends and proactively identifying areas of risk
  • Supporting subcontractor safety compliance and expectations
  • Building a strong, proactive safety-first culture across field operations
